High Quality hot air cabinet with 10m³ internal volume designed to withstand the corrosive environment inherently created within them by the combination of high temperature, moisture and often chemically active atmosphere created by the drying process. Moisture within the cabinet is prevented from passing through the internal walls to corrode the cabinet's framework by a combination of the use of "blind" stainless steel rivets and specific sealing of all internal joints. Robust refrigeration style handles are fitted to the cabinet door/s which allow external and internal operation.

Drying Oven working principle
An industrial drying oven for sample preparation is a robust and high-precision piece of equipment used in laboratories and mining facilities to remove moisture from samples, typically minerals, ores, or geological materials.
These ovens operate at controlled temperatures, often ranging from ambient to several hundred degrees Celsius, to ensure consistent and uniform drying without altering the chemical or physical properties of the material.
Constructed from durable materials like stainless steel and equipped with advanced temperature control systems, industrial drying ovens provide a stable environment for rapid, efficient moisture removal, which is essential for accurate sample
analysis in processes like weighing, grinding, and chemical testing. With features like forced air circulation for even heat distribution and programmable settings for different drying protocols, they are essential for preparing samples for subsequent testing or analysis.
